/aosp14/system/core/libutils/include/utils/ |
H A D | String8.h | 40 class String8 44 String8(const String8& o); 164 String8 walkPath(String8* outRemains = nullptr) const; 243 inline const String8 String8::empty() { in empty() 256 inline std::string String8::std_string(const String8& str) in std_string() 281 inline String8& String8::operator=(const String8& other) 287 inline String8& String8::operator=(const char* other) 293 inline String8& String8::operator+=(const String8& other) 299 inline String8 String8::operator+(const String8& other) const 306 inline String8& String8::operator+=(const char* other) [all …]
|
/aosp14/frameworks/base/tools/aapt/ |
H A D | AaptAssets.h | 121 String8 toDirName(const String8& resType) const; 194 String8 mPath; 211 AaptGroup(const String8& leaf, const String8& path) in AaptGroup() 231 String8 mLeaf; 232 String8 mPath; 244 AaptDir(const String8& leaf, const String8& path) in AaptDir() 298 String8 mLeaf; 299 String8 mPath; 357 String8 stringVal; 380 status_t addStringSymbol(const String8& name, const String8& value, in addStringSymbol() [all …]
|
H A D | AaptXml.cpp | 27 String8* outError) { in getStringAttributeAtIndex() 33 return String8(); in getStringAttributeAtIndex() 40 return String8(); in getStringAttributeAtIndex() 45 return str ? String8(str, len) : String8(); in getStringAttributeAtIndex() 83 return String8(); in getAttribute() 91 return String8(); in getAttribute() 100 return String8(); in getResolvedAttribute() 108 return String8(); in getResolvedAttribute() 115 return str ? String8(str, len) : String8(); in getResolvedAttribute() 124 return String8(); in getResolvedAttribute() [all …]
|
H A D | Command.cpp | 233 uint32_t attrRes, const String8& attrLabel, String8* outError) in printResolvedResourceAttribute() 300 String8 getComponentName(String8 &pkgName, String8 &componentName) { in getComponentName() 356 const String8& requiredFeature = String8::empty(), in printUsesPermission() 357 const String8& requiredNotFeature = String8::empty()) { in printUsesPermission() 414 String8 error; in getNfcAidCategories() 480 String8 name; 517 String8 label; 532 String8 name8(name); in hasFeature() 542 String8 name8(name); in addImpliedFeature() 1082 String8 pkg; in doDump() [all …]
|
H A D | AaptUtil.cpp | 20 using android::String8; 24 Vector<String8> split(const String8& str, const char sep) { in split() 25 Vector<String8> parts; in split() 32 parts.add(String8(p, strlen(p))); in split() 36 parts.add(String8(p, q-p)); in split() 42 Vector<String8> splitAndLowerCase(const String8& str, const char sep) { in splitAndLowerCase() 43 Vector<String8> parts; in splitAndLowerCase() 50 String8 val(p, strlen(p)); in splitAndLowerCase() 56 String8 val(p, q-p); in splitAndLowerCase()
|
H A D | AaptXml.h | 37 android::String8 getAttribute(const android::ResXMLTree& tree, const char* ns, 38 const char* attr, android::String8* outError = NULL); 46 android::String8* outError = NULL); 62 const char* attr, android::String8* outError) { in getIntegerAttribute() 72 int32_t defValue = -1, android::String8* outError = NULL); 80 android::String8* outError) { in getIntegerAttribute() 91 android::String8* outError = NULL); 100 android::String8* outError) { in getResolvedIntegerAttribute() 109 android::String8 getResolvedAttribute(const android::ResTable& resTable, 111 android::String8* outError = NULL); [all …]
|
H A D | FileFinder.h | 25 virtual bool findFiles(String8 basePath, Vector<String8>& extensions, 26 KeyedVector<String8,time_t>& fileStore, 56 virtual bool findFiles(String8 basePath, Vector<String8>& extensions, 57 KeyedVector<String8,time_t>& fileStore, 75 static void checkAndAddFile(const String8& path, const struct stat* stats, 76 Vector<String8>& extensions, 77 KeyedVector<String8,time_t>& fileStore);
|
H A D | CacheUpdater.h | 36 virtual void ensureDirectoriesExist(String8 path) = 0; 39 virtual void deleteFile(String8 path) = 0; 42 virtual void processImage(String8 source, String8 dest) = 0; 58 virtual void ensureDirectoriesExist(String8 path) in ensureDirectoriesExist() 61 String8 existsPath; in ensureDirectoriesExist() 62 String8 toCreate; in ensureDirectoriesExist() 63 String8 remains; in ensureDirectoriesExist() 94 virtual void deleteFile(String8 path) in deleteFile() 101 virtual void processImage(String8 source, String8 dest) in processImage()
|
H A D | FileFinder.cpp | 20 using android::String8; 41 bool SystemFileFinder::findFiles(String8 basePath, Vector<String8>& extensions, in findFiles() 42 KeyedVector<String8,time_t>& fileStore, in findFiles() argument 56 String8 entryName(entry->d_name); in findFiles() 60 String8 fullPath = basePath.appendPathCopy(entryName); in findFiles() 80 void SystemFileFinder::checkAndAddFile(const String8& path, const struct stat* stats, in checkAndAddFile() 81 Vector<String8>& extensions, in checkAndAddFile() 82 KeyedVector<String8,time_t>& fileStore) in checkAndAddFile() argument 86 String8 ext(path.getPathExtension()); in checkAndAddFile() 89 String8 ext2 = extensions[i].getPathExtension(); in checkAndAddFile()
|
H A D | Bundle.h | 318 android::String8 mConfigurations; 319 android::String8 mPreferredDensity; 320 android::Vector<android::String8> mPartialConfigurations; 321 android::Vector<android::String8> mPackageIncludes; 327 android::String8 mFeatureOfPackage; 328 android::String8 mFeatureAfterPackage; 329 android::String8 mRevisionCode; 353 android::String8 mCompileSdkVersionCodename; 354 android::String8 mPlatformVersionCode; 355 android::String8 mPlatformVersionName; [all …]
|
H A D | CrunchCache.h | 32 CrunchCache(String8 sourcePath, String8 destPath, FileFinder* ff); 84 bool needsUpdating(const String8& relativePath) const; 88 String8 mSourcePath; 89 String8 mDestPath; 91 Vector<String8> mExtensions; 95 DefaultKeyedVector<String8,time_t> mSourceFiles; 96 DefaultKeyedVector<String8,time_t> mDestFiles;
|
H A D | Resource.cpp | 58 String8 parseResourceName(const String8& leaf) in parseResourceName() 78 Vector<String8>() in FilePathStore() 163 String8 mResType; 172 String8 mBaseName; 173 String8 mLeafName; 174 String8 mPath; 2205 static String8 flattenSymbol(const String8& symbol) { in flattenSymbol() 2230 static String8 getSymbolName(const String8& symbol) { in getSymbolName() 2936 KeyedVector<String8, SortedVector<String8> > rules; 2938 void add(const String8& rule, const String8& where); [all …]
|
/aosp14/system/core/libutils/ |
H A D | String8.cpp | 126 String8::String8() in String8() function in android::String8 131 String8::String8(const String8& o) in String8() function in android::String8 137 String8::String8(const char* o) in String8() function in android::String8 153 String8::String8(const String16& o) in String8() function in android::String8 158 String8::String8(const char16_t* o) in String8() function in android::String8 168 String8::String8(const char32_t* o) in String8() function in android::String8 176 String8::~String8() in ~String8() 209 void String8::setTo(const String8& other) in setTo() 460 String8 String8::getPathDir(void) const in getPathDir() 472 String8 String8::walkPath(String8* outRemains) const in walkPath() [all …]
|
H A D | String8_fuzz.cpp | 30 std::vector<std::function<void(FuzzedDataProvider*, android::String8*, android::String8*)>> 33 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0102() 36 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0202() 39 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0302() 44 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0402() 71 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0a02() 74 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0b02() 77 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0c02() 80 [](FuzzedDataProvider*, android::String8* str1, android::String8*) -> void { in __anon14e4abfe0d02() 216 android::String8 str_one_utf8 = android::String8(vec.data()); in LLVMFuzzerTestOneInput() [all …]
|
H A D | String8_test.cpp | 37 String8 tmp("Hello, world!"); in TEST_F() 43 String8 src1("Hello, "); in TEST_F() 47 String8 dst1 = src1 + ccsrc2; in TEST_F() 53 String8 ssrc2("world!"); in TEST_F() 54 String8 dst2 = src1 + ssrc2; in TEST_F() 61 String8 src1("My voice"); in TEST_F() 64 String8 src2(" is my passport."); in TEST_F() 87 String8 string8(string16); in TEST_F() 96 String8 string8(string32); in TEST_F() 102 String8 valid = String8(String16(tmp)); in TEST_F() [all …]
|
/aosp14/system/core/healthd/include/healthd/ |
H A D | healthd.h | 60 android::String8 batteryStatusPath; 61 android::String8 batteryHealthPath; 62 android::String8 batteryPresentPath; 63 android::String8 batteryCapacityPath; 64 android::String8 batteryVoltagePath; 66 android::String8 batteryTechnologyPath; 67 android::String8 batteryCurrentNowPath; 68 android::String8 batteryCurrentAvgPath; 70 android::String8 batteryFullChargePath; 79 android::String8 chargingStatePath; [all …]
|
/aosp14/frameworks/base/libs/androidfw/include/androidfw/ |
H A D | AssetManager.h | 131 String8 getAssetPath(const int32_t cookie) const; 222 String8 path; 225 String8 idmap; 235 String8 createZipSourceNameLocked(const String8& zipFileName, 236 const String8& dirName, const String8& fileName); 284 SharedZip(int fd, const String8& path); 287 String8 mPath; 316 ZipFileRO* getZip(const String8& path); 327 static String8 getPathName(const char* path); 337 int getIndex(const String8& zip) const; [all …]
|
H A D | BackupHelpers.h | 55 String8 file; 74 status_t WriteEntityHeader(const String8& key, size_t dataSize); 85 void SetKeyPrefix(const String8& keyPrefix); 95 String8 m_keyPrefix; 115 status_t ReadEntityHeader(String8* key, size_t* dataSize); 133 String8 m_key; 139 int write_tarfile(const String8& packageName, const String8& domain, 140 const String8& rootPath, const String8& filePath, off64_t* outSize, 149 status_t WriteFile(const String8& filename, BackupDataReader* in); 155 KeyedVector<String8,FileRec> m_files;
|
H A D | AssetDir.h | 53 const String8& getFileName(int idx) { in getFileName() 56 const String8& getSourceName(int idx) { in getSourceName() 81 explicit FileInfo(const String8& path) // useful for e.g. svect.indexOf in FileInfo() 110 void set(const String8& path, FileType type) { in set() 115 const String8& getFileName(void) const { return mFileName; } in getFileName() 116 void setFileName(const String8& path) { mFileName = path; } in setFileName() 121 const String8& getSourceName(void) const { return mSourceName; } in getSourceName() 122 void setSourceName(const String8& path) { mSourceName = path; } in setSourceName() 129 const String8& fileName); 132 String8 mFileName; // filename only [all …]
|
/aosp14/frameworks/base/tools/aapt/tests/ |
H A D | FileFinder_test.cpp | 27 String8 path("ApiDemos"); in main() 30 KeyedVector<String8,time_t> testStorage; in main() 33 Vector< pair<String8,time_t> > data; in main() 34 data.push( pair<String8,time_t>(String8("hello.png"),3) ); in main() 35 data.push( pair<String8,time_t>(String8("world.PNG"),3) ); in main() 36 data.push( pair<String8,time_t>(String8("foo.pNg"),3) ); in main() 38 data.push( pair<String8,time_t>(String8("hello.jpg"),3) ); in main() 39 data.push( pair<String8,time_t>(String8(".hidden.png"),3)); in main() 44 Vector<String8> exts; in main() 45 exts.push(String8(".png")); in main() [all …]
|
H A D | CrunchCache_test.cpp | 29 String8 source("res"); in main() 30 String8 dest("res2"); in main() 33 KeyedVector<String8, time_t> sourceData; in main() 35 sourceData.add(String8("res/drawable/hello.png"),3); in main() 41 KeyedVector<String8, time_t> destData; in main() 42 destData.add(String8("res2/drawable/hello.png"),3); in main() 43 destData.add(String8("res2/drawable/world.png"),3); in main() 45 destData.add(String8("res2/drawable/dead.png"),3); in main() 48 KeyedVector<String8, KeyedVector<String8,time_t> > data; in main() 88 String8 source2("ApiDemos/res"); in main() [all …]
|
H A D | AaptGroupEntry_test.cpp | 23 using android::String8; 25 static ::testing::AssertionResult TestParse(AaptGroupEntry& entry, const String8& dirName, in TestParse() 26 String8* outType) { in TestParse() 34 String8* outType) { in TestParse() 35 return TestParse(entry, String8(input), outType); in TestParse() 40 String8 type; in TEST() 42 EXPECT_EQ(String8("menu"), type); in TEST() 47 String8 type; in TEST() 49 EXPECT_EQ(String8("anim"), type); in TEST() 52 EXPECT_EQ(String8("animator"), type); in TEST()
|
H A D | AaptConfig_test.cpp | 24 using android::String8; 27 if (AaptConfig::parse(String8(input), config)) { in TestParse() 34 return TestParse(String8(input), config); in TestParse() 54 EXPECT_EQ(String8(""), config.toString()); in TEST() 57 EXPECT_EQ(String8("fr-land"), config.toString()); in TEST() 68 EXPECT_EQ(String8("en-rUS"), config.toString()); in TEST() 74 EXPECT_EQ(String8("sw600dp-v13"), config.toString()); in TEST() 77 EXPECT_EQ(String8("sw600dp-v13"), config.toString()); in TEST() 92 EXPECT_EQ(String8("round-v23"), config.toString()); in TEST() 107 EXPECT_EQ(String8("widecg-v26"), config.toString()); in TEST() [all …]
|
H A D | Pseudolocales_test.cpp | 24 using android::String8; 31 String16 result = pseudo.start() + pseudo.text(String16(String8(input))) + pseudo.end(); in simple_helper() 33 ASSERT_EQ(String8(expected), String8(result)); in simple_helper() 40 pseudo.text(String16(String8(in1))) + \ in compound_helper() 41 pseudo.text(String16(String8(in2))) + \ in compound_helper() 42 pseudo.text(String16(String8(in3))) + \ in compound_helper() 44 ASSERT_EQ(String8(expected), String8(result)); in compound_helper() 217 String16 result = pseudo.text(String16(String8("Hello, "))); in TEST() 219 result.append(pseudo.text(String16(String8("world!")))); in TEST() 220 ASSERT_EQ(String8("Ĥéļļö, world!"), String8(result)); in TEST()
|
H A D | MockFileFinder.h | 18 MockFileFinder (KeyedVector<String8, KeyedVector<String8,time_t> >& files) in MockFileFinder() argument 35 virtual bool findFiles(String8 basePath, Vector<String8>& extensions, in findFiles() 36 KeyedVector<String8,time_t>& fileStore, in findFiles() argument 39 const KeyedVector<String8,time_t>* payload(&mFiles.valueFor(basePath)); in findFiles() 51 KeyedVector<String8, KeyedVector<String8,time_t> > mFiles;
|